Victoria’s Jason Willow drafted by Baltimore Orioles

Willow is one of five players from B.C. in this year’s MLB draft.
web1_20170614-KCN-M-JasonWillow

Greater Victoria native Jason Willow has been drafted to the Baltimore Orioles.

The right-handed infielder plays for the B.C. Premier Leagues’ Victoria Mariners, and has commited to UC-Santa Barbara. He was the selected in the 24th round (728th overall).

A total of 20 Canadians were selected over the three-day MLB draft, including 16 on the final day on Wednesday.

Five were from B.C.
